RHSA-2024:6973: Moderate: dovecot security update
Dovecot is an IMAP server for Linux and other UNIX-like systems, written primarily with security in mind. It also contains a small POP3 server, and supports e-mail in either the maildir or mbox format. The SQL drivers and authentication plug-ins are provided as subpackages. <br>Security Fix(es):<br><li> dovecot: using a large number of address headers may trigger a denial of service (CVE-2024-23184)</li> <li> dovecot: very large headers can cause resource exhaustion when parsing message (CVE-2024-23185)</li> For more details about the security issue(s), including the impact, a CVSS score, acknowledgments, and other related information, refer to the CVE page(s) listed in the References section.
